ABOUTResource Public Key Infrastructure is a specialized public key infrastructure framework to improve security for the Internet's BGP routing infrastructure. RPKI provides a way to connect Internet number resource information (such as ASN and IP addresses) to a trust anchor. Wikipedia ↗︎

ABOUTInternet Exchange Points (IXes or IXPs) are physical places where infrastructure companies interconnect with each other to exchange data destined for their respective networks. These locations are critical for companies to shorten their connection paths to other network participant, this allows for reduced round-trip time and low latency. Wikipedia ↗︎
